BLUEBERRY CUSTARD PIE

Time 1h

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 cups blueberries
1 baked 9 inch pie shell, well chilled
1 tablespoon flour
1 cup sugar
1 cup evaporated milk
3 large eggs, lightly beaten
1 teaspoon vanilla

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ees.
  • Place blueberries in pie crust; set aside.
  • In a medium bowl, mix flour and sugar; gradually add evaporated milk, stirring until smooth.
  • Whisk in eggs and vanilla until blended; pour mixture over blueberries.
  • If desired, sprinkle with a dash each of cinnamon and nutmeg.
  • Bake 15 minutes; reduce heat to 350 degrees.
  • Bake 35 minutes longer.
  • Cool completely before slicing.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 386.3, Fat 13.1, SaturatedFat 5.1, Cholesterol 105.2, Sodium 200.8, Carbohydrate 60.4, Fiber 2.1, Sugar 39.5, Protein 8.2
